The difference between incandescent and halogen lamps

In our home life, incandescent lamps and halogen lamps are two common light bulbs. Many people easily confuse the two light bulbs. So how to distinguish between incandescent lamps and halogen lamps?

1. The light-emitting principle is different

Incandescent lamps are direct heat illuminators, which are resistive, and are made of tungsten filaments. The interior of the bulb is filled with nitrogen. The light-emitting principle of halogen lamps is ionized light, which belongs to high-pressure lamps. In addition, halogen lamps are also filled with 95% mixed gas and 5% high-purity nitrogen. These gases are inside the bulb, and a halogen-tungsten cycle is established.

2. The appearance is different

Halogen bulbs are generally small in size and high in power, while incandescent bulbs are generally small in power and large in size. The most intuitive difference is that the surface of the halogen lamp is a milky white glass shell, which is filled with some halogen element gases, while the incandescent lamp is just a more common transparent glass shell.

3. Different color temperature and light

Due to the special luminous principle of halogen lamp, halogen lamp will have brighter brightness due to higher temperature in normal operation, which is far more bright than incandescent lamp in brightness and different from incandescent lamp in color temperature and luminous efficiency. 

4. Different service life

The principle of the halogen-tungsten cycle of the halogen lamp makes the tungsten on the filament of the halogen lamp not gradually volatilize due to the long use time, and the phenomenon of the bulb turning black will not occur, so the service life is relatively long. Incandescent lamps usually have the problem of blackening of the bulb after a period of use, which affects the overall service life.

5. Different energy saving effects

Although halogen lamps are brighter than incandescent lamps, they are more energy efficient and environmentally friendly than incandescent lamps.

Knowing these points makes it easy to distinguish between incandescent and halogen lamps!
